Bucim has completed a development programme for 30 representatives of middle management, delivered in cooperation with NLP Macedonia – Center for Business Psychology SEE.
The programme forms part of the company’s broader approach to continuously strengthening employees’ knowledge and skills in line with their professional roles, responsibilities and the evolving needs of the business.
In a modern mining and production environment, the development of human capital is essential for the safe, efficient and responsible management of complex operations. For this reason, Bucim supports a range of professional development initiatives, from technical and occupational safety training to the advancement of leadership, organisational and management capabilities.
The programme focused on practical aspects of leadership, including setting clear tasks and expectations, coordinating and motivating teams, decision-making, managing change and responding constructively to different workplace situations.
Through practical exercises, discussions and the analysis of examples from everyday operations, participants exchanged experience and explored approaches applicable to their direct work with people and processes.
